How to water the Monopoly Spring

How to water the Monopoly Spring

Watering method:

Importance of watering during the growing season:

During the growth period, any lack of water will affect its normal growth, so friends must pay attention during this period;

Watering intervals during the growing season:

The watering interval during the growing period can be determined according to the suitable soil for planting. The watering time for different soils is also different. If it is pumice stone, red brick particles, volcanic stone, etc., water it once a day; if it is humus soil, pond mud, etc., water it every two to three days.

Watering time during the growing season:

It is best to do it in the morning or evening, and avoid watering at noon.

Watering methods during the growing season:

The best state of soil is 20% wet and 80% dry. You can water it when the soil in the pot is almost dry, but do not water it half and leave half. This is very bad for the soil and will affect the health of the plants, so be sure to water it thoroughly.

In fact, daily watering:

Except for the growing season, it is best to water at 10 o'clock and 16 o'clock, and keep the soil slightly dry on a daily basis. Before watering in winter, let the water sit for a while and let the water temperature reach above 15 degrees before watering.

Note:

Excessive watering can cause a variety of diseases, so be sure to control the amount of water when watering.
